I use a cheap propane oven because that is what is in my apartment. I had to learn how to cook the crust, sauce, and vegetables in that oven. I used to make pizzas in an electric oven with a pizza stone, and that is different. All I can say is experiment with temperatures and placement. Maybe you can partially cook the crust and sauce, add the vegetables and move the pizza up to the broiler rack. In my oven I have to put the crust on a cookie sheet on the bottom because that is where the flame is. When the bottom is done, I turn the crust over, put the sauce on it, and add the vegeatables. When the bottom of the crust is done (again), I move the pizza up to the top rack so the vegetables get more time to cook without burning my crust. There is no broiler in my oven, but that is what works for me.
